Poured from a bomber into a Dogfish Head tulip. 2016 anniversary brew
L: Inky dark pour with a finger of mocha head. Great lacing.
S: Rich chocolate, roast, and bourbon.
T.F: Just like it smells. Sweet and boozy up front. Bourbon and vanilla with a swirl of milk chocolate. Some roast for balance... mild espresso notes and oak, but the big guns are the chocolate and roast. Medium bodied... sticky on the tongue and oily. Smooth (thank you oatmeal). Moderate carbonation.
O: An outstanding big bourbon-aged stout. Great flavor and a nice dessert/evening sipper.
